DESCRIPTION
The LP5522 is a simple single wire programmable
LED controller in six bump DSBGA package. It
provides constant current flow through high side
driver. Output current can be set from 1 mA to 20 mA
by using an external resistor on the ISET pin. If no
external resistor is used, output current is set to 5 mA
default current. The LP5522 is controlled using only
one signal. The signal controls either directly the LED
driver or it launches previously programmed blinking
sequence.

The LP5522 works autonomously without a clock
signal from the master device. Very low LED driver
headroom voltage makes possible to use supply
voltages close to LED forward voltage. Current
consumption of the LP5522 is minimized when LED
is turned off and once controller is disabled all
supporting functions are also shut down. Very small
DSBGA package together with minimum number of
external components is a best fit for handheld
devices.
